Arabalicious is a website full of resources for teachers of Arabic, run by Taoufiq Cherkaoui. The website includes PowerPoints available for download on concepts such as telling time, fruits and vegetables, culture, and basic greetings, to name a few. Worksheets to go along with the PowerPoints are also available for free download. The website further includes pictures that are available with the author's permission and some postings on available jobs for Arabic instructors as per 2012.

Class slides for Strategic Management are freely-available, screen-reader friendly, openly-licensed, and editable. The slides align with the freely-available open textbook, Strategic Management, which is the required text for Virginia Tech's Pamplin College of Business undergraduate capstone course, MGT 4394 Strategic Management. The collection includes eleven chapter-level .ppt slides with questions and activities, and additional slide decks with exercises and cases.

The open textbook, Strategic Management is freely available in PDF, ePub, Pressbooks, and other formats at http://hdl.handle.net/10919/99282

About the license Unless otherwise noted, the book, slides, and contents there in are licensed with a Creative Commons NonCommercial ShareAlike (CC BY NC SA) 3.0 license, which allows anyone to remix, tweak, and build upon the work for uses which are primarily non-commercial. New works must acknowledge the original work and must be licensed under the same CC BY NC SA 3.0 license. See Creative Commons' Best Practices for Attribution for further information: https://wiki.creativecommons.org/wiki/Best_practices_for_attribution.

Help us! If you are an instructor reviewing, adopting, or adapting this textbook and/or slides, please help us understand your use by filling out this form http://bit.ly/strategy-interest

How to adapt and share the slides
Instructors are encouraged to customize the slide deck by adding their own content and examples. According to the Creative Commons BY NC SA license, customized and shared versions of the slides must:
- Retain the original copyright statement
- Be released under the Creative Commons Attribution NonCommercial-ShareAlike (CC BY NC SA) 3.0 license
- Include a link to the original slide deck source: http://hdl.handle.net/10919/102735
- Include brief statement regarding whether or not changes were made
- List the the name of the adapter.

College Physics for AP Courses is designed to engage students in their exploration of physics and help them to relate what they learn in the classroom to their lives and to apply these concepts to the Advanced Placement test. Physics underlies much of what is happening today in other sciences and in technology, therefore the book includes interesting facts and ideas that go beyond the scope of the AP course to further student understanding. The AP Connection in each chapter directs students to the material they should focus on for the AP® exam, and what content — although interesting — is not necessarily part of the AP curriculum.

A colourful and fun superhero-themed slideshow presentation designed to teach students how to create effective slideshow presentations. A Google slides presentation that you can adopt / adapt for your classroom. Best suited for grades 5-8 but may work in higher grades too.

Outlines 7 tips for effective slideshow presentations:

1. Fantastic Fonts
2. Stupendous Size
3. Terrific Text
4. Cool Colours
5. Glorious Graphics & Videos
6. Sensational Slides
7. *BONUS* Incredible Interactions
